PR libstdc++/29134 (ext/vstring bits)
2006-09-21 Paolo Carlini <pcarlini@suse.de> PR libstdc++/29134 (ext/vstring bits) * include/ext/sso_string_base.h (__sso_string_base<>::_S_max_size): Remove. (__sso_string_base<>::_M_max_size): Use allocator' max_size. (__sso_string_base<>::_M_create): Adjust. * include/ext/vstring.h: Minor comment tweak. * testsuite/ext/vstring/capacity/29134.cc: New. From-SVN: r117109
